Você está na página 1de 8

PESQUISA OPERACIONAL

MTODO SIMPLEX
QUADRO SIMPLEX
O Mtodo Simplex um procedimento matricial para resolver o modelo de
programao linear na forma normal.
Comeando com X0 , o mtodo localiza sucessivamente outras solues
bsicas viveis acarretando melhores valores para a funo objetivo at ser
obtida a soluo tima.
Para os problemas de minimizao, o mtodo simplex utiliza o Quadro
abaixo.

XT
CT
A

X0 C0
T

C C

B
T
0

C0 B

Para os problemas de maximizao o Quadro acima aplicado desde que


os elementos da linha inferior sejam colocados com sinal invertido.
Uma vez obtida esta ultima linha do Quadro, a segunda linha e a segunda
coluna do Quadro, correspondentes a CT e C0, respectivamente, tornam-se
suprfluas e podem ser eliminadas.

CT : vetor linha dos custos correspondentes.


X : o vetor coluna de incgnitas (incluindo variveis de folga, excesso e artificiais).
A : a matriz de coeficientes das equaes de restries.
B : o vetor coluna dos valores direita das equaes representando as restries.
X0: o vetor coluna de variveis de folga e artificiais
C0 : o vetor coluna de custo associado com as variveis em X0

Prof. Clio Moliterno

PESQUISA OPERACIONAL
Exemplo:
Minimizar: z = 80x1 + 60x2
Sujeito a :

0,20x1 + 0,32x2 0,25


x2 = 1
x1 +

com:

x1

x2 no negativos

Adicionando uma varivel de folga x3 e uma varivel artificial x4,


respectivamente, as primeira e segunda restries.
Minimizar: z = 80x1 + 60x2 + 0x3 + Mx4
0,20x1 + 0,32x2 + x3
= 0,25
x1 +
x2
+x4 = 1
com todas as variveis no negativas
Passando para forma normal matricial
X

C C

T
0

[ x1 , x2 , x3 , x4 ] T
0,20 0,32 1 0
1
1
0 1

A = [ 80 , 60 , 0 , M ] [ 0 , M ]

[ 80 , 60 , 0 , M ]T
0,25
1

X0

x
x

3
4

0,20 0,32 1 0
1
1
0 1

[ 80 , 60 , 0 , M ] [ 0 + M , 0 + M , 0 , M ]
[ 80 , 60 , 0 , M ] [ M , M , 0 , M ]

[ 80 M , 60 M , 0 , 0 ]
T

C0 B = -[0,M]

0,25
1

=-M

Prof. Clio Moliterno

PESQUISA OPERACIONAL
QUADRO SIMPLEX

X1
80

X2
60

X3
0

X4
M

X3 0

0,20

0,32

0,25

X4 M

-M

80-M 60-M

Exerccio:
Maximizar:

z = x1 + 9x2 + x3

sujeito a:

x1 + 2x2 + 3x3
3x1 + 2x2 + 2x3

9
15

com: todas as variveis no negativas

Passando para forma Matricial

[ x1 , x2 , x3 , x4 , x5 ] T

1 2 3 1 0
3 2 2 0 1

9
15

[ 1 , 9 , 1 , 0 , 0 ]T

X0

x
x

4
5

Prof. Clio Moliterno

PESQUISA OPERACIONAL
QUADRO SIMPLEX

X1
1

X2
9

X3
1

X4
0

X5
0

X4 0

X5 0

15

QUADRO 1

(Quadro inicial completo)

X1

X2

X3

X4

X5

X4

X5

15

-1

-9

-1

C C

T
0

9
T

C0 B

Prof. Clio Moliterno

PESQUISA OPERACIONAL

O MTODO SIMPLEX
Passo 1
Localize o nmero mais negativo da ltima linha do quadro
simplex, excluda a ltima coluna, e chame a coluna em que este nmero
aparece de coluna de trabalho. Se existir mais de um candidato a nmero
mais negativo, escolha um.
Passo 2 Forme quocientes da diviso de cada nmero positivo da coluna
de trabalho pelo elemento da ltima coluna da linha correspondente
(excluindo-se a ltima linha do quadro).Designe por piv o elemento da
coluna de trabalho que conduz ao menor quociente. Se mais de um
elemento conduzir ao mesmo menor quociente, escolha um. Se nenhum
elemento da coluna de trabalho for positivo, o problema no ter soluo.
Passo 3 Use operaes elementares sobre as linhas a fim de converter o
elemento piv em 1 e, em seguida, reduzir a zero todos os outros elementos
da coluna de trabalho.
Passo 4 Substitua a varivel x existente na linha piv e primeira coluna
pela varivel x da primeira linha e coluna piv. Esta nova primeira coluna
o novo conjunto de variveis bsicas.
Passo 5 Repita os passos de 1 a 4 at a inexistncia de nmeros negativos
na ltima linha, excluindo-se desta apreciao a ltima coluna.
Passo 6
A soluo tima obtida atribuindo-se a cada varivel da
primeira coluna o valor da linha correspondente, na ltima coluna. s
demais variveis atribudo o valor zero. O valor timo da funo objetivo,
associado a Z, o nmero resultante na ltima linha, ltima coluna, nos
problemas de maximizao ou o negativo deste nmero, nos problemas de
minimizao.

Prof. Clio Moliterno

PESQUISA OPERACIONAL
Passo 1
Coluna de trabalho

X1

X2

X3

X4

X5

X4

X5

15

-1

-9

-1

Mais negativo

Passo 2
Coluna de trabalho

X1

X2

X3

X4

X5

X4

2*

9/2 = 4,5

X5

15

15/2 = 7,5

-1

-9

-1

Piv

Prof. Clio Moliterno

PESQUISA OPERACIONAL
Passo 3a

X1

X2

X4

1/2

X5

3
-1

X3

X4

X5

3/2

1/2

9/2

15

-9

-1

Multiplicando todos os elementos


da linha do Piv, pelo inverso do
Piv.
Lembrar que o inverso de
2 1/2 , o inverso de 3/4 4/3.

Passo 3b

X1

X2

X3

X4

X5

X4

1/2

1*

3/2

1/2

9/2

X5

15

7/2

25/2

9/2

81/2

X1

X2

X3

X4

X5

X4

1/2

1*

3/2

1/2

9/2

X5

-1

-1

7/2

25/2

81/2

Reduzindo a zero o elemento -9:


Multiplica-se por 9 a linha que
contem o Piv, em seguida faa
uma soma algbrica com a linha
que contem o elemento -9
9 x 1/2 = 9/2
9/2 + (-1) = 7/2
9x 1 = 9
9 + (-9) = 0
9 x 3/2 = 27/2 27/2 + (-1) = 25/2
9 x 1/2 = 9/2
9/2 + 0 = 9/2
9x 0 = 0
0 +0 = 0
9 x 9/2 = 81/2 81/2 + 0 = 81/2

Passo 3c

9/2

Reduzindo a zero o elemento 2:


Multiplica-se por -2 a linha que
contem o Piv, em seguida faa
uma soma algbrica com a linha
que contem o elemento 2

Prof. Clio Moliterno

PESQUISA OPERACIONAL

Passo 4
X1

X2

X3

X4

X2

1/2

3/2

1/2

9/2

X5

-1

-1

7/2

25/2

81/2

9/2

X5

Passo 5
No necessrio aplicar, pois no existe nmeros negativos na ltima
linha.
Passo 6
X2 = 9/2, X5 = 6, X1 = X3 = X4 = 0
Z = 81/2
Exerccio para o Lar:
Problema da fabrica de rdios.
Maximizar: z = 30ST + 40LX
Sujeito a:

ST
24
LX 16
ST + 2LX

(obs: faa ST = X1 e LX = X2)

40

Sendo ST e LX variveis inteiras e positivas

Prof. Clio Moliterno

Você também pode gostar